Sydelle Janofsky's Obituary
Sydelle Janofsky, age 89, went to her eternal rest on September 13, 2019. For 50 happy years she was the beloved wife of Arnold Janofsky (deceased).
Services will be held on Wednesday, September 18 at 11:30 a.m. at Beth David Memorial Gardens, Hollywood, Florida.
Sydelle is survived by her loving children Robyn (Richard) Hubbard and Corey (Donna) Janofsky. Her daughter, Andrea, preceded her in death.
Always a kind soul who adored her family first and foremost, Sydelle is also survived by her loving grandchildren Jason (Andrea) Cioc, Maren Oser, Lauren (Ryan) Williams, Ashley (David) Lopez, Gregory Janofsky, and Brandon Janofsky as well as her great-grandchildren Braden Cioc, Juniper, Xyla and Sage Oser, and Owen and Alexandra Williams. She is also survived by her nieces and nephews Jeff, Paula, Paul, Stefanie, Brian, Laura, Alex, Hayley and Charlie.
Sydelle passed away peacefully at the Oak Manor Nursing Home in Largo, Florida, after a long illness.
Sydelle and Arnold lived most of their long and happy marriage in Howard Beach, New York. In their later years, they resided in Pembroke Pines, Florida. Sydelle had resided for the last 12 years with her daughter Robyn and son-in-law, Richard.
Sydelle loved life and loved people. A devoted homemaker, her children always came first. Her stuffed cabbage was unmatched! Always an attractive woman, Sydelle took great pleasure in her appearance. Even well into her 80’s people would still comment on how beautiful she was.
Everyone also noticed and appreciated her wry sense of humor.
